JKPM | Jurnal Karya Pendidikan Matematika | P-ISSN: 2339-2444 E-ISSN: 2549-8401 is peer reviewed journal that contains the work of the field of educational research or teaching mathematics, mathematics, mathematical applications, mathematical computerization and models of mathematics education in the learning process. JKPM published twice a year, every April and September.

Abstract

Mathematical literacy relates to how people apply knowledge in real-life situations. Based on the results of PISA from 2000 to 2018, the mathematical literacy of Indonesian students is still low. The use of inappropriate teaching media is one cause of this issue, thus there is a need for technology-integrated innovation to help improve mathematical literacy. The research is experimental with a one-group pretest-posttest design. The implementation is carried out systematically by administering a pretest, then treatment, followed by a posttest. The pretest results had an average of 41.44 and the posttest results were 75.49, indicating an increase in average test scores. The pre-analysis test indicates the research instruments are feasible to use, while the paired sample t-test results show 0.000 < 0.05, indicating the VR Tour website media with an ethnomathematics approach has a significant effect on mathematical literacy. Further data analysis from the n-gain test shows 0.30 < 0.5870 < 0.70, which has medium criteria, thus indicating an increase in mathematical literacy before and after the VR Tour website media with an ethnomathematics approach. The conclusion is that the VR Tour website media with an ethnomathematics approach is effective in improving mathematical literacy.

Abstract

Penelitian ini bertujuan mengembangkan aktivitas pembelajaran berbasis PMR dengan MathCityMap untuk mendukung kemampuan pemecahan masalah matematis siswa SMP. Menggunakan model ADDIE (Analyze, Design, Development, Implementation, Evaluation), penelitian melibatkan 16 siswa kelas VIII MTs Negeri 10 Sleman. Data dikumpulkan melalui wawancara guru, validasi media pembelajaran, tes, dan kuesioner siswa. Hasil penelitian menunjukkan aktivitas pembelajaran dengan MathCityMap yang dikembangkan menggunakan ADDIE. Pada tahap Analyze, dilakukan analisis kebutuhan belajar. Pada tahap Design, dipilih media pembelajaran dan disusun tes kriteria. Pada tahap Development, dilakukan pengembangan, validasi ahli, dan revisi. Pada tahap Implementation, dilakukan uji coba. Pada tahap Evaluation, ditinjau kualitas produk. MathCityMap valid (82,3%), praktis (77,7%), dan cukup efektif (62,25%) mendukung pembelajaran bangun ruang sisi datar.

Abstract

The purpose of this study was to produce a valid Sigil Software-assisted e-Module on the subject of Quadratic Equations and Functions at XI Hospitality 1 SMK Negeri 6 Padang. The method used is Research and Development (R&D) based on the Plomp model. The stages used in the plomp model are only stages 1 to stage 2, namely the initial investigation and prototyping phase concurrently testing the validity. The instruments used were validation questionnaires and interview guidelines. Based on the validator's assessment, the results of the validity of the sigil software-assisted e-Module were 90.34% in a very valid category. Based on the results of the study it was concluded that the sigil software-assisted e-Module on the material Equations and Quadratic Functions in class XI Hospitality 1 SMK Negeri 6 Padang was declared valid to be used and tested by teachers and students.

Abstract

One of the important abilities in a person's cognitive is the ability of memory, one of which is short-term memory (STM). This study investigates the relationship between Short-Term Memory (STM) and math learning outcomes. The researcher conducts a literature review to gather information and then performs an experiment to measure STM in a class of grade X students in a private school in Bekasi City. The study discusses various information about STM and its connection to students' math learning outcomes. The researcher develops an instrument to measure memory span and administers a test to obtain STM scores, correlating with student learning outcomes using Pearson simple correlation analysis. The results reveal a very low correlation (r=0.104) between STM and grade X learning outcomes in this study. The study concludes that STM does not significantly impact students' learning outcomes since long-term memory is where learners store their general knowledge, school learnings, and personal memories. It suggests that students must review previously studied materials before being assessed to achieve optimal learning results. Other factors that affect learning outcomes include students' psychological factors like interest, intelligence, talent, motivation, and cognitive abilities.

Abstract

Students that possess mathematical comprehension ability are able to reason rationally and solve difficulties in both ordinary life and mathematical contexts. Low comprehension skills are exhibited by SLB C Yakut Purwokerto students with modest intellectual impairments. This is a result of the continued use of traditional learning materials, which makes learning challenging for kids. As a result, learning media play a crucial role in education. Students will be more motivated to participate in learning to enhance their mathematics comprehension skills when they are exposed to high-quality learning materials. Thus, the goal of this project is to create interactive learning materials based on PowerPoint that are reliable and efficient for enhancing mathematical comprehension. Research and Development (R&D) is the research methodology employed. With a proportion of material expert validation of 80%, media expert validation of 82.5%, trials by math instructors of 86%, and field trials of 91.3%, the research's findings demonstrate that the media produced is legitimate and appropriate for usage. In addition, interactive learning materials based on PowerPoint were shown to be successful, with the experimental class outperforming the control group in terms of N-Gain. The experimental class's N-Gain score was 77.1%, compared to only 23.8% for the control group. This research concludes that PowerPoint-based interactive media is effective in improving mathematical understanding of students with intellectual disabilities.

Abstract

Pendidikan bertujuan untuk mempersiapkan generasi muda menghadapi perkembangan zaman dengan meningkatkan kualitas sumber daya manusia (SDM). Salah satu komponen kunci dalam meningkatkan efektivitas pengajaran, khususnya dalam pelajaran matematika, adalah media pembelajaran. Namun, siswa kelas IV MI Nurul Islam sering mengalami kesulitan memahami materi pecahan karena kurangnya metode pengajaran yang interaktif. Penelitian ini bertujuan untuk mengembangkan dan menguji efektivitas media pembelajaran digital yaitu Digital Smart Book yang dirancang menggunakan aplikasi Canva untuk membantu siswa memahami materi pecahan. Metode Penelitian dan Pengembangan (R&D) digunakan dalam penelitian ini dengan model ADDIE, yang meliputi tahapan analisis, desain, pengembangan, implementasi, dan evaluasi. Hasil validasi menunjukkan bahwa media ini sangat valid (75%), praktis (95%), dan efektif (92%) dalam meningkatkan pemahaman siswa. Dengan demikian, Digital Smart Book dinilai layak untuk digunakan dalam pengajaran matematika.

Abstract

Digital literacy is a skill that learners must have. This ability is the basis in shaping students' critical and creative reasoning. In shaping students' mathematical literacy, interesting learning media is needed. This learning media can be in the form of ICT or Manipulative. The RIMath application is an android-based learning media that can facilitate students' mathematical literacy. RIMath learning media presents mathematics learning that applies contextual problems while integrating the Qur'an. The type of research used in this study is R&D (Research and Development) using the 4D method (Define, Design, Develop and Disseminate). RIMath learning media will be validated to experts to ensure the quality of this learning media. RIMath learning media will also be tested with students to ensure that the RIMath application can facilitate students' mathematical literacy. RIMath learning media gets a feasibility percentage of 78.283%. This percentage proves that RIMath learning media is included in the "feasible" category to be used by students in learning mathematics. In a t-test experiment, RIMath learning is proven to improve students' mathematical literacy by working on math problems.

Abstract

This research aims to describe junior high school students' mathematical communication skills in Quadratic Function material. This type of research is descriptive qualitative. The subjects were taken from 2 students each with high, medium and low mathematics abilities in class IX of SMP Negeri 6 Semarang 2023/2024. Data collection was carried out using mathematical communication tests, interviews and documentation. The data analysis technique was carried out in 3 stages, namely data reduction, data presentation and drawing conclusions. The data validity checking technique uses the triangulation method. Based on the results of research conducted by researchers, it was found that subjects with high mathematical abilities and subjects with moderate mathematical abilities were able to fulfill all the mathematical communication indicators given in the questions/problem solving. These indicators are 1) Ability to express problem situations in pictures or graphs (drawing) 2) Ability to express problem situations in the form of mathematical models (mathematical expressions) 3) Ability to explain the solution of ideas or situations from an image given in the model mathematics is in the form of mathematical writing (writing). Meanwhile, subjects with low mathematical abilities are unable to fulfill all the mathematical communication indicators given in the questions/problem solving.

Abstract

This study is motivated by the low critical thinking skills of X MP 3 grade students at SMKN 1 Surabaya, where 22 out of 35 students failed to meet the Minimum Competency Criteria (KKM) in the pre-test. Teacher-centered learning often overlooks the varying levels of student understanding, leading to gaps that need to be addressed. This classroom action research aims to improve students' critical thinking skills through the Teaching at the Right Level (TaRL) approach, which is tailored to the specific needs of each student. Conducted in two cycles, the study shows significant improvement in students' critical thinking abilities. The average pre-test score was 51.00 with a 37% pass rate. After implementing TaRL, the average score on the first post-test at the end of the first cycle increased to 70.86 with a 69% pass rate, and the second post-test at the end of the second cycle showed an increase to 83.77 with an 83% pass rate. This improvement indicates progress in interpreting, analyzing, evaluating, and making inferences. TaRL proved to be effective and is recommended for further exploration regarding its long-term impact and scalability in education.

Abstract

This study aims to describe the self-efficacy and mathematical understanding abilities of students at SMP Negeri 1 Kontukowuna and to analyze the influence of self-efficacy on the mathematical understanding abilities of these students. The population of this study consists of all 47 seventh-grade students at SMP Negeri 1 Kontukowuna. The sample was determined using a total sampling technique. Data analysis techniques include descriptive analysis and inferential analysis. Data collection techniques involve using a self-efficacy questionnaire and a mathematical understanding test. The results of the data analysis showed that 8.51% of students have very high self-efficacy, 19.15% have high self-efficacy, 42.55% have moderate self-efficacy, 27% have low self-efficacy, and 2.13% have very low self-efficacy. Furthermore, 17.02% of students have high mathematical understanding abilities, 70.21% have moderate mathematical understanding abilities, 12.77% have low mathematical understanding abilities, and no students fall into the very high or very low categories. Finally, it was found that there is a significant positive influence of self-efficacy on the mathematical understanding abilities of seventh-grade students at SMP Negeri 1 Kontukowuna, with a significance level of . The regression equation is , and the coefficient of determination () is 0.223, which means that self-efficacy (X) contributes 22.3% to mathematical understanding (Y), while the remaining 77.7% is influenced by other factors outside the independent variable (X) not discussed in this study.
